云迁移过程如何避免停机

简介:

在公共云迁移过程中,IT团队需要采取一种一步一随的谨慎做法以避免发生可怕的“系统关闭”事件。

随着众多企业迁移至基于云的基础设施,IT团队需要确保在迁移过程中的可用性。但是考虑到所涉及的复杂性,在云迁移过程中防止或最小化停机时间并不容易。云团队需要考虑数据的不一致性、监控不同的软件版本并检查其网络连接是否成功。

如果企业的应用程序停用,那么其业务就会中断。虽然精确的指标因具体公司和应用而有所不同,但是Gartner在2014年发现,网络停机事件的平均成本为5,600美元/分钟。停机事件的高昂成本也是企业通常将他们最负责工作负载迁移至其他平台(包括云)的原因之一。

企业用户仍然以一个较快的速度扩大着公共云的应用范围。Forrester Research预测,2017年全球公共云市场将达到1460亿美元,高于2015年的870亿美元。

看不清的前景

对于选择迁移至云的企业来说,未来的前景是有好有坏的。任何的云迁移过程都是困难的。移动信息需要付出大量的时间与精力,即便生产系统与目标系统是完全兼容的。您的云供应商所运行系统与用户内部使用系统相同的可能性极小,所以云迁移挑战难度呈指数级增长。

在另一方面,如今的计算基础设施较以往更显模块化。

“虚拟化使企业更容易地实现不同系统之间的工作负载迁移,”Forrester Research的首席分析师兼基础设施即服务私有云负责人Lauren E. Nelson说。

虚拟化创建了一个抽象层,所以软件不再像过去那样那么的依赖于系统特性。应用程序也不再与操作系统紧密相连,而往往更依赖于哪些服务器资源可用。其缺点是现代工作负载通常是大而复杂的。大多数功能的实现都需要数亿行以上的代码。此外,其模块化设计则意味着它们能够与许多其他系统(例如用于身份管理的系统)进行交互。

从哪里开始云迁移过程

将用户所有的应用程序和支持基础设施一下子都迁移至公共云是不可行的。

“如果应用程序数量众多,那么迁移过程需要花上六至十八个月,” Nelson说。

将整个云迁移过程分解为可管理的若干步骤。从最小、最简单的项目开始,然后是更大更复杂的项目。在迁移过程中,并行运行内部部署和云计算系统、同步数据并测试云部署,以确保迁移过程中没有遗漏。另外,记录所有的API以便了解在云迁移过程中用户需要监控哪些API.

当企业用户将其原来的接口映射至新接口时,成功的关键在于细节。例如,一个应用程序可能运行4.0版的用户接口,而云供应商则使用4.1版,这就有可能包括一个应用程序不支持的功能并防止系统中运行过程中崩溃。

定制,网络面临迁移挑战

在云迁移过程中,区分企业服务或简化操作的定制应用程序会带来额外的挑战。当企业改写应用程序时,通常会创建一个附加组件或重写软件。如果云供应商缺乏支持独特功能所需的软件,那么这种定制就可能带来问题。

网络通信是与公共云相关的另一个重要因素。当企业用户将信息从内部迁移至场外时,他们需要确保其WAN链接的传输速度足够快以提供足够的性能。在某些情况下,这需要升级。

在将工作负载迁移至云时,企业会面临众多的挑战,但是公共云供应商们提供了相关的工具与服务以简化云迁移过程。

本文转自d1net(转载)

相关文章
|
数据可视化 关系型数据库 MySQL
2023年职业院校技能大赛中职组----大数据应用与服务赛项任务书试题
2023年职业院校技能大赛中职组----大数据应用与服务赛项任务书试题
1288 0
|
存储 设计模式 网络协议
AD域 概述以及结构与存储技术
AD域 概述以及结构与存储技术
1695 0
AD域 概述以及结构与存储技术
|
机器学习/深度学习 算法 PyTorch
深度学习经典算法PPO的通俗理解
#1 前置知识点 基本概念 [https://www.yuque.com/docs/share/04b60c4c-90ec-49c7-8a47-0dae7d3c78c7?#](https://www.yuque.com/docs/share/04b60c4c-90ec-49c7-8a47-0dae7d3c78c7?#) (部分符合的定义在这里) 要理解PPO,就必须先理解Actor
9683 0
|
8月前
|
存储 人工智能 运维
当四大美女遇上 MetaGPT,一键解锁跨时空AI畅聊新体验
MetaGPT 是一个开源多智能体框架,通过角色专业化分工与流程标准化控制,突破传统单模型系统的能力瓶颈。本方案结合阿里云百炼模型服务和 Serverless AI 开发平台 Function AI,构建支持多角色、多场景的对话应用,并部署至函数计算。用户可快速获取 API-KEY、配置参数并部署项目,体验如“西游取经”、“成语接龙”等示例应用,实现高效协同推理与垂直领域专业内容动态更新,显著降低成本并提升开发效率。
|
10月前
|
监控 数据可视化 数据挖掘
【开发者必看—电商篇】数据赋能电商类App转化率循序增长
通过友盟+ 数据分析工具,团队深入分析了用户行为路径、转化漏斗、停留时间及错误事件等关键数据,定位到用户体验与产品性能的问题。经过精准优化,包括简化购物流程、修复技术故障及提升稳定性,最终显著提高了用户转化率。这一案例展示了数据驱动在产品优化中的重要作用。
【开发者必看—电商篇】数据赋能电商类App转化率循序增长
|
9月前
|
安全 PHP 监控
织梦CMS迁移的技术路线分析与实践建议
随着技术发展,织梦CMS因安全风险、技术滞后及生态萎缩等问题亟需迁移。相比织梦,WordPress凭借持续迭代和现代化技术栈成为优选。针对迁移需求,提供三种方案:全量数据迁移适合中小型站点;渐进式重构适用于大型平台;生态转换迁移助力拥抱现代开发体系。实施中注重数据精准性、服务器优化与模板适配,并通过风险控制保障业务连续性和SEO效果。从技术生命力、生态完备性和迁移可行性三维度构建决策框架,借助Websoft9等工具实现平稳升级,助企业构建现代化数字化平台。
252 0
|
编解码 流计算
直播推流的工作原理是什么
直播推流将视频和音频数据从设备实时传输到服务器并分发给观众,涉及采集、编码、推流、传输、拉流和显示六个关键步骤。首先通过摄像机或麦克风采集音视频,再利用编码器如OBS压缩数据,采用H.264等格式编码,接着通过RTMP等协议推流至服务器,服务器调整格式后通过HLS等协议分发给不同设备,观众即可实时观看。此流程确保了低延迟的全球内容传递。
|
监控 数据可视化 安全
Zabbix 主要功能特点
Zabbix 主要功能特点
545 8
|
弹性计算 监控 负载均衡
slb健康检查注意事项
slb健康检查注意事项
243 1
|
存储 弹性计算 运维
阿里云轻量应用服务器与标准型阿里云服务器ECS全面对比(配置、价格)
随着云计算技术的蓬勃发展,阿里云作为业界的佼佼者,推出了多样化的云服务器产品以满足不同用户群体的需求。在这些产品中,阿里云轻量应用服务器与标准云服务器(ECS)因其各自的特点而备受关注。下面,我们将从多个角度对这两款产品进行深入剖析,以帮助您更好地选择适合自身需求的云服务器。
1255 2